Chapter 1
Introduction
This manual explains how to uninstall a DW4000, DW6000, or
DW7000 remote terminal and replace it with your new HN7000S
remote terminal.

System requirements
The HN7000S self-hosted remote terminal is designed to connect
to your computer. To operate in conjunction with the Hughes
network, your computer must meet the following requirements:
Operating system
PC: Windows XP, Windows 2000, Windows Me, Windows
98 SE
MAC: 10.1 or higher
Processor
PC: Pentium II 333 Mhz or faster
MAC: 300 Mhz or faster
